ACQUIRING TRAVEL TIME AND NETWORK LEVEL ORIGIN-DESTINATION DATA ANALYSIS BY MACHINE VISION ANALYSIS OF VIDEO PLATE IMAGES
This study presents an evaluation of the current state-of-practice employing video and machine vision technologies to acquire and analyze license plate images. Both fixed installations and mobile setups are considered. Examples are presented of various applications including: cordon-line origin-destination surveys; link-by-link travel time distributions; micro-scale origin-destination patterns; movements within complex interchanges; and, designing and monitoring use of high occupancy vehicle lanes. Field procedures, resource requirements and the statistical validity of the results of various applications are discussed.
